Output e39f3dbce3517df7f86c9cf5707d1274a4f14a0bcc061507a6fd0a6f222f317b:9

value
80477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34459d9506bb15b22490dac32cfaac2e7c380bde OP_EQUAL
address
36TQTVX4B54T3wFZHrwxsXPTSa1XcNzXa6
transaction
e39f3dbce3517df7f86c9cf5707d1274a4f14a0bcc061507a6fd0a6f222f317b
confirmations
249873
spent
true